LUXURY PACKAGING & LETTERPRESS EMBOSSING
Hot Foil Stamping & Embossing Die Vector Prepress Guide
Hot foil stamping applies metallic or pigment foil (Kurz, Crown Roll Leaf) to premium paper, leather, and folding carton substrates using heat ($100^\circ ext{C} - 160^\circ ext{C}$) and hydraulic pressure. The image is stamped using a metal die etched in magnesium (chemical acid etch) or CNC-engraved in brass or copper. To ensure crisp foil release without bridging (foil fill-in between tight lines) or paper tearing, vector artwork must respect minimum line widths, draft tapers, and relief depth rules.

1. Die Metal Comparison: Brass vs Magnesium vs Copper
| Die Metal | Manufacturing Method | Production Run Life | Edge Crispness & Relief Depth |
|---|---|---|---|
| CNC Engraved Brass | 3D CNC High-Speed Milling | 500,000+ impressions | Razor sharp; multi-level Bas-Relief & combo foil/emboss |
| Etched Magnesium | Nitric Acid Chemical Etch | 10,000 - 25,000 impressions | Fast turnaround, economical short runs; standard single-level |
| Etched Copper | Ferric Chloride Acid Etch | 100,000+ impressions | Harder than magnesium; excellent heat retention for textured stock |
2. Vector Prepress Specifications
- Minimum Positive Vector Line Width: Maintain $\ge 0.15\text{mm}$ ($0.45\text{ pt}$) on smooth coated paper; maintain $\ge 0.25\text{mm}$ on heavy linen or textured stock.
- Minimum Negative (Reverse) Line Gap: Maintain $\ge 0.30\text{mm}$ clearance between parallel lines. Under heat and dwell pressure, molten foil adhesive spreads outwards and will fill in tight reverse gaps.
- Relief Depth: For flat paper stamping, use $1.2 - 1.5\text{mm}$ relief. For deep debossing or leather, use $2.0 - 3.0\text{mm}$ with a $20^\circ$ draft angle taper.
